What is a Reliability Program Manager?

A Reliability Program Manager is a professional responsible for developing, implementing, and managing programs that ensure the dependability and optimal performance of systems, equipment, or processes within an organization. They analyze data, identify potential risks, and create strategies to minimize downtime and improve reliability. Their role often involves cross-functional collaboration, continuous improvement initiatives, and adherence to industry standards and best practices. Reliability Program Managers are commonly found in sectors like manufacturing, energy, aerospace, and technology.

How does a Reliability Program Manager typically collaborate with engineering and operations teams to drive improvements?

A Reliability Program Manager works closely with both engineering and operations teams to identify areas where equipment or process reliability can be enhanced. This involves facilitating cross-functional meetings, analyzing failure data, and aligning improvement initiatives with production goals. The manager often acts as a bridge, translating technical findings into actionable plans that operations can implement. Effective communication and the ability to prioritize projects based on impact and resource availability are key to successful collaboration.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Reliability Program Manager, and why are they important?

A Reliability Program Manager typically needs a solid background in engineering, reliability analysis, and project management, often supported by a relevant degree and certifications like Certified Reliability Engineer (CRE). Familiarity with reliability modeling software, root cause analysis tools, and asset management systems is common in the role.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ills are crucial for effectively coordinating teams and driving reliability initiatives. These skills are essential to ensure equipment uptime, reduce operational risks, and optimize organizational performance.

What is the difference between Reliability Program Manager vs Maintenance Engineer?

AspectReliability Program ManagerMaintenance Engineer
Primary FocusDeveloping and implementing reliability strategies to improve equipment uptimePerforming maintenance tasks to repair and maintain equipment
CertificationsReliability certifications (e.g., RCM, RCPE) often preferredMechanical or electrical engineering degrees, maintenance certifications
Work EnvironmentOffice-based planning, cross-department collaborationFieldwork, plant or facility maintenance
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, energy, and industrial sectorsCommon in manufacturing, facilities management, and industrial plants

The Reliability Program Manager focuses on strategic reliability initiatives to prevent failures, while Maintenance Engineers handle hands-on repair and maintenance tasks. Both roles are essential for operational efficiency but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

As a Development Manager will lead a team of full-stack engineers building and maintaining enterprise-scale web applications for the automotive retail industry. You will be deeply involved in code reviews, process improvement, and cross-functional collaboration with Product Owners, QA, and vendor partners to ensure high-quality, timely releases across multiple initiatives.

This role reports to the VP of Web/Digital Engineering and is a key technical leadership role for someone who still enjoys staying close to the code while mentoring developers and improving how we deliver software.

Responsibilities

  • Lead, mentor, and grow a team of full-stack developers working primarily in C#, .NET Core, and Vue.js.
  • Conduct code reviews and establish coding standards to maintain code quality, scalability, and security.
  • Collaborate closely with Product Owners to refine requirements, estimate effort, and prioritize sprint deliverables.
  • Manage and coordinate third-party vendors and offshore teams to ensure aligned execution and technical consistency.
  • Define and enforce development processes, including branching strategy, CI/CD, and QA/testing practices.
  • Oversee release management and ensure smooth deployment across staging and production environments hosted in Google Cloud Platform (GCP).
  • Partner with architecture and DevOps teams on performance, scalability, and infrastructure optimization within GCP.
  • Encourage and promote the use of AI-assisted coding tools (such as GitHub Copilot, OpenAI, or similar platforms) to expedite development output and enhance team productivity.
  • Track project health through KPIs such as sprint velocity, defect rates, and on-time delivery metrics.
  • Foster a culture of technical excellence, accountability, and continuous learning.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or related field (or equivalent experience)
  • 7+ years of professional software development experience, including 2+ years in a leadership or management role
  • Strong technical expertise in C#, ASP.NET Core, REST APIs, SQL Server, and modern JavaScript frameworks (Vue.js preferred)
  • Experience leading or contributing to enterprise-level SaaS or marketing platforms
  • Proficient with Git, DevOps, Jira, and agile development methodologies
  • Proven ability to manage vendors or offshore teams, balancing speed with quality
  • Excellent communication skills with the ability to bridge business and technical discussions

Preferred Experience

  • Familiarity with automotive digital retailing, dealer website platforms, or marketing automation systems
  • Hands-on experience with Google Cloud Platform (GCP), including Compute Engine, Cloud SQL, Cloud Run, and Cloud Storage
  • Exposure to microservices, containerization (Docker/Kubernetes), and API-first architecture
  • Knowledge of performance tuning, load testing, and accessibility/SEO best practices.
  • Demonstrated success introducing or scaling AI-driven coding or automation tools to enhance developer efficiency
